This week, Dylan and Hayden dive into a topic that’s flying under the radar but changing the future of teaching forever.
UK birth rates have fallen to historic lows – and now schools are feeling the impact. From empty classrooms and school closures to teacher redundancies and disappearing job ads, this episode uncovers how a quiet demographic shift is creating a very loud crisis in education.
🔍 We unpack:
* The *huge* drop in UK birth rate – and why it’s happening
* Why schools across the country are merging, shrinking, or closing altogether
* How fewer children means fewer teaching jobs – even if you're brilliant
* Why a fall in teacher vacancies isn’t always a good sign
* Our personal story
